.about__container{max-width:var(--max-width);grid-template-columns:1fr 1.5fr;align-items:center;gap:4rem;display:grid}.about__image-wrapper{position:relative}.about__image-wrapper:before{content:"";border-radius:var(--radius-xl);background:var(--gradient-primary);opacity:.15;z-index:-1;position:absolute;inset:-8px}.about__image{border-radius:var(--radius-xl);aspect-ratio:1;transition:var(--transition-slow);overflow:hidden}.about__image img{object-fit:cover;width:100%;height:100%;transition:var(--transition-slow)}.about__image:hover img{transform:scale(1.03)}.about__cards{grid-template-columns:repeat(2,1fr);gap:1.25rem;margin-bottom:2rem;display:grid}.about__card{background:var(--color-bg-variant);border:1px solid var(--border-subtle);border-radius:var(--radius-lg);transition:var(--transition);align-items:flex-start;gap:1rem;padding:1.5rem;display:flex}.about__card:hover{border-color:var(--border-medium);box-shadow:var(--shadow-glow);transform:translateY(-2px)}.about__card-icon{color:var(--color-primary);flex-shrink:0;margin-top:2px;font-size:1.5rem}.about__card-text h3{margin-bottom:.25rem;font-size:1rem}.about__card-text p{color:var(--color-light);font-size:.875rem}.about__description{color:var(--color-light);margin-bottom:2rem;line-height:1.8}@media screen and (max-width:1024px){.about__container{grid-template-columns:1fr;gap:2.5rem}.about__image-wrapper{width:50%;margin:0 auto}}@media screen and (max-width:600px){.about__image-wrapper{width:70%}.about__cards{grid-template-columns:1fr}.about__content{text-align:center}.about__card{justify-content:center}.about__content .btn{margin:0 auto}}
.experience__container{max-width:var(--max-width);grid-template-columns:repeat(3,1fr);gap:2.5rem;display:grid}.experience__group{background:var(--color-bg-variant);border:1px solid var(--border-subtle);border-radius:var(--radius-xl);transition:var(--transition);padding:2.5rem}.experience__group:hover{border-color:var(--border-medium);box-shadow:var(--shadow-glow)}.experience__group h3{color:var(--color-primary);text-align:center;text-transform:uppercase;letter-spacing:.05em;margin-bottom:2rem;font-size:1.1rem}.experience__list{grid-template-columns:1fr 1fr;gap:1.25rem;display:grid}.experience__skill{align-items:center;gap:.75rem;padding:.5rem 0;display:flex}.experience__skill-icon{color:var(--color-primary);flex-shrink:0;font-size:1rem}.experience__skill span{color:var(--color-light);font-size:.95rem}.experience__cta{text-align:center;margin-top:2.5rem}.experience__cta .btn{align-items:center;gap:.5rem;display:inline-flex}@media screen and (max-width:1024px){.experience__container{grid-template-columns:1fr 1fr}.experience__group{width:100%;max-width:600px;margin:0 auto}.experience__group:last-child{grid-column:1/-1;max-width:400px}}@media screen and (max-width:768px){.experience__container{grid-template-columns:1fr}.experience__group:last-child{grid-column:auto;max-width:600px}}@media screen and (max-width:600px){.experience__group{padding:1.5rem}.experience__list{grid-template-columns:1fr}}
